maddie is on the weightlifting team at her school. She must lift as much as possible from ground to a straight up standing position. How much work will Maddie do if she uses a force of 6 N to lift 150 kg of weight to a height of 1.5 m?

work= force x distance
A)3.5 j
B)6.5 j
C)3.3 j
D)9.0 j

To calculate the work done by Maddie, we use the formula: work = force x distance.

In this case, the force applied by Maddie is 6 N, and the distance she lifts the weight is 1.5 m.

Therefore, the work done by Maddie is: work = 6 N x 1.5 m = 9 J.

The correct answer is D) 9.0 J.
